Do I need the hazard perception test if I have an overseas licence?
Some overseas licence holders converting to a Victorian licence are required to complete the hazard perception test, it depends on individual circumstances, so it’s worth checking directly with VicRoads.
Is the hazard perception test hard to pass?
It isn’t designed to be difficult if you’ve had genuine driving exposure and understand the “See, Think, Do” framework. Practising with official sample tests beforehand significantly improves your confidence and pass rate.
What is the minimum age for the hazard perception test?
You must be at least 17 years and 11 months old and hold a current Victorian learner permit.
Can I do the hazard perception test online?
Yes. You can complete the hazard perception test online through your myVicRoads account, or in person at a VicRoads Customer Service Centre if you prefer.
How much does the hazard perception test cost in Victoria?
Your first attempt online is free. Each additional attempt after a failed test costs $20.70.
